Hex is an agentic analytics platform built around a multiplayer notebook where SQL, Python, R, and no-code coexist, extended with a family of agents that do real analytical work. The Notebook Agent, launched August 2025 and substantially expanded since, acts as a pair programmer that writes and edits code, understands upstream and downstream dependencies in a flow, debugs its own work, performs agentic search to discover the right data sources, executes analysis by writing and running code to transform, visualize, and model data, and summarizes results in plain language. Hex's stated differentiator is that data work needs more than code generation: it needs analytics-specific tooling grounded in governed context, so the agent draws on Context Studio and semantic models plus live warehouse schemas rather than guessing. Threads provides conversational self-serve for non-technical stakeholders, and the two halves compound: every Thread becomes a Hex project the data team can open as a notebook for inspection or deeper analysis with full transparency into the agent's reasoning, while published work becomes context that Threads references in future answers. Hex Magic supplies inline AI autocomplete with error explanation and join suggestions, Generative Apps builds dashboards and data apps from a prompt, and a Modeling Agent assists semantic model creation. The company frames data teams as the governors of AI answer quality, much as they curate trusted dashboards today. Privacy is handled with zero data retention agreements with model providers by default, metadata held in a secure database inside Hex's architecture, and no provider training on customer data. Within the data analyst lane, Hex is the notebook-native platform tier: where point tools answer questions, Hex compounds analyst work and governed context into a system where both agentic analysis and conversational self-serve run on the same trusted foundation.

Integrations

Connects to data warehouses with live schema access, unifying SQL, Python, R, and no-code in one workspace. The Notebook Agent uses analytics-specific tooling as its action surface (chart styling, input parameters, single-value cells, modeling) rather than generic code generation, and performs agentic search across data sources. Ships a Hex CLI, embedded analytics, scheduled runs and alerts, and publishes notebooks as interactive data apps that end users can chat with.
